Perks of Signing Up With a Weight Loss Clinic



If you're looking to drop weight and stay determined, signing up with a weight loss clinic can use you various benefits. Among the major advantages is the assistance and assistance you obtain from professionals that focus on weight loss. They can produce a customized strategy tailored to your details demands and objectives, assisting you make healthier food options and create an exercise regimen that benefits you.

Furthermore, being part of a weight loss clinic supplies a sense of community and accountability. You can connect with others who get on the very same journey as you, sharing experiences, challenges, and triumphes. This support system can maintain you motivated and inspired, particularly during challenging times.

Moreover, weight loss clinics often use academic resources, workshops, and seminars to help you gain expertise about proper nutrition, portion control, and sustainable way of living changes.

Drawbacks of Signing Up With a Weight Loss Clinic



While there are numerous advantages to joining a weight loss clinic, there are likewise some drawbacks to consider.

Among the primary disadvantages is the price. Weight loss clinics can be rather expensive, especially if you have to spend for numerous sessions or a lasting program.

Another drawback is the moment commitment. Participating in normal appointments and following the center's program can take up a substantial quantity of your time, which might be difficult to handle if you have a hectic schedule.

Additionally, some individuals might locate the rigorous guidelines and guidelines of a weight loss clinic to be as well limiting or challenging to comply with.

It is very important to consider these downsides against the potential advantages prior to deciding to sign up with a weight loss clinic.
